Obnova dat ze zálohy pomoc dd pro Windows

Obnova dat ze zálohy pomoc dd pro Windows
« kdy: 26. 07. 2015, 11:55:27 »
Zdravím, mám takový menší problém. Zazálohoval jsem si oddíl s Windows XP oddílem na prvním disku. Pak jsem přerozdělil celou partition table. Když jsem chtěl oddíl obnovit a porovnal jsem velikosti dostal jsem toto:

aktuální velikost oddílu: 9 663 672 320 bytů (vytvořeno v G-parted)
správná velikost má být:  9 663 676 416 bytů (tj. 9*1024)
záloha má:        9 664 667 648 bytů (přitom oddíl byl kdysi vytvořen taky v G-parted a měl mít 9*1024 bytů)

Z toho vyplývá, že záloha je o něco větší. Dá se obnovit záloha tak, aby se tam vešla? Jak zadat specifikace bs a count?
Zkoušel jsem toto:

Kód: [Vybrat]
dd if=L:\bottom_C_XP1.dd of=\\.\x:  bs=1M count=9216
9216+0 records in
9215+2 records out

A nevím co znamenají ty čísla hlavně +0 a +2? Vím že když by se to povedlo tak by tam bylo něco jako 9216+0 u obou.
Když teď kliknu na X: tak mi to píše hlášku že disketa není naformátovaná a nabízí možnost naformátovat oddíl (oddíl je typu raw).


Jenda

Re:Obnova dat ze zálohy pomoc dd pro Windows
« Odpověď #1 kdy: 26. 07. 2015, 13:11:04 »
> Dá se obnovit záloha tak, aby se tam vešla?

Nejspíš ne. Musíš ji rozbalit někam jinam a pomocí ntfsresize ji zmenšit. (nebo ji zmenšit inplace pokud tam kde je se k tomu dá přistupovat jako k blokovému zařízení)

> A nevím co znamenají ty čísla hlavně +0 a +2?

https://unix.stackexchange.com/questions/121865/create-random-data-with-dd-and-get-partial-read-warning-is-the-data-after-the

> Když teď kliknu na X: tak mi to píše hlášku že disketa není naformátovaná

Doporučil bych použít nějaký operační systém který umožňuje debugování a dává smysluplné chybové hlášky.

Re:Obnova dat ze zálohy pomoc dd pro Windows
« Odpověď #2 kdy: 26. 07. 2015, 19:40:29 »
Čím si vysvětlujete to že velikost oddílů není správná 9*1024*1024*1024 ? Je možné že by to Gparted nějak zaokrouhloval nebo měnil nebo jsem spíš já špatně opsal číslo? Když vezmu velikost oddílu 9663672320 a podělím 1024/1024 tak dostávám 9215,99609375 MB, čili tuto hodnotu jsem snad v Gparted ani nemohl zadat. Čili nechápu jak to vzniklo. Ale teď se dívám i na ostatní oddíli a Windows ukazuje méně než jsem zadával. Tak že by to Windows XP ukazovaly špatně?

Jenda

Re:Obnova dat ze zálohy pomoc dd pro Windows
« Odpověď #3 kdy: 26. 07. 2015, 20:43:25 »
Čím si vysvětlujete to že velikost oddílů není správná 9*1024*1024*1024 ? Je možné že by to Gparted nějak zaokrouhloval nebo měnil nebo jsem spíš já špatně opsal číslo? Když vezmu velikost oddílu 9663672320 a podělím 1024/1024 tak dostávám 9215,99609375 MB
1) MiB

2) Zaokrouhlil to na sektory (512 nebo 4096).

3) V této situaci vždycky partition udělám o trochu větší, FS se zvětšuje snadno, zmenšení je komplikované.
Ale teď se dívám i na ostatní oddíli a Windows ukazuje méně než jsem zadával. Tak že by to Windows XP ukazovaly špatně?
Netuším, kde se to ve Windows ukazuje? Průzkumník ukazuje velikost FS po naformátování, navíc různě pletou jednotky.

Re:Obnova dat ze zálohy pomoc dd pro Windows
« Odpověď #4 kdy: 26. 07. 2015, 21:37:28 »
Běžně používám Disk Managment, kliknu na disk a vyberu vlastnosti. To samé se dá udělat z Průzkumníka.
Jo tak teď jsem to porovnal a není to to samé. Takže v tom Disk Managmentu to asi ukazuje špatně! Zaokrouhlil.


Re:Obnova dat ze zálohy pomoc dd pro Windows
« Odpověď #5 kdy: 26. 07. 2015, 21:41:04 »
zaokrouhlil to na sektory, ale myslíš Gparted, Disk Managment nebo průzkumíka? V Disk Managementu jsou ty oddíly menší o 0,01 GB (nejsou to celé GB). V průzkumníku jsou celé GB. Otázka ale je kdo to ukazuje špatně jestli Disk Managment nebo Průzkumník.
C:\WINDOWS\system32\diskmgmt.msc